Yet there was a time when Bharat built differently. Our ancestors didn’t just construct buildings; they crafted sanctuaries. They didn’t merely arrange bricks and mortar; they orchestrated harmony between earth and sky, between human needs and cosmic rhythms. From the sloping wooden roofs of Kerala that married themselves to monsoon rains, to the intricate courtyards of Karnataka that captured cool breezes, every structure spoke the local dialect of its landscape. These were not arbitrary choices but intelligent, climatically sensitive adaptations, showcasing a deep understanding of local environmental conditions.


Architecture wasn’t an aesthetic pursuit—it was a dharmic one. A sacred responsibility. In this context, Dharma refers to righteous conduct, moral duty, and the natural order of the universe. Applied to architecture, it implies designing and building in a way that aligns with ethical principles, promotes well-being, and respects natural and cosmic order.

Consider the ancient concept of Panchavati—the sacred grove of five trees that formed the heart of traditional settlements. These weren’t decorative gardens but living medicine chests, spiritual anchors, and ecological sanctuaries rolled into one sacred space. The Peepal (Ficus religiosa) provided oxygen and served as a meditation focal point, revered in Hinduism, Buddhism, and Jainism. The Belpatra (Aegle marmelos) offered Ayurvedic healing and connected inhabitants to Shiva consciousness. The Banyan (Ficus benghalensis) created community gathering spaces under its vast canopy, symbolizing longevity and community. The Amla (Phyllanthus emblica) delivered vitamin C and spiritual cleansing, highly valued in Ayurveda. The Ashoka (Saraca asoca) brought feminine healing energy and reminded all of life’s deeper sorrows and joys.

The Lost Science of Sacred Geometry


Modern architecture begins with utility: How many square feet? What’s the budget? Where’s the parking? These aren’t wrong questions, but they’re incomplete. Ancient Bharatiya architecture began with a deeper inquiry: What kind of life are we designing for? How can this structure align its inhabitants with dharma, with nature, with the divine currents that flow through existence?
This inquiry led to Vastu Shastra—not the commercialized version that reduces sacred geometry to superstitious dos and don’ts, but the original science that understood buildings as living energy systems. Vastu Shastra is an ancient Indian system of architecture and design principles that aims to integrate architecture with nature, human life, and cosmic energies.
 
Vastu recognizes that every space vibrates with the interplay of five elements, known as Pancha Bhutas:
Earth (Prithvi): Represents stability, foundation, and form.
Water (Jal): Symbolizes flow, purity, and emotions.
Fire (Agni): Represents energy, transformation, and light.
Air (Vayu): Signifies movement, breath, and communication.
Space (Akasha): Encompasses all other elements, representing emptiness, vastness, and potential.
 
When these elements achieve balance within a structure, something magical happens. Inhabitants experience what researchers now document as reduced psychological stress, improved family relationships, enhanced creativity, and deepened spiritual awareness.


But Vastu goes beyond individual wellbeing. It creates structures that breathe with natural rhythms—drawing in cooling breezes during hot afternoons, maximizing natural light during winter months, channeling rainwater to recharge groundwater rather than creating urban floods.

Designing for Dharmic Living


What does it mean to design for dharmic living in the 21st century? It means creating spaces that support not just modern convenience but ancient wisdom practices that keep humans connected to their deeper nature.


An ideal Bharatiya home today would seamlessly integrate (this is not exhaustive list by any means):


Sacred Cooking Spaces: Kitchens designed for Ayurvedic food preparation, with proper ventilation for spice grinding, granite or stone surfaces for chapati making, and dedicated areas for fermentation and sprouting. Storage designed for buying seasonal, local ingredients rather than processed foods that last months.


Natural Light Therapy Areas: Spaces specifically designed for early morning sun exposure and sunset gazing—practices our ancestors knew were essential for mental health and circadian rhythm regulation long before modern science “discovered” light therapy.


Ritual and Meditation Zones: Dedicated spaces for daily spiritual practices, whether Agnihotri, yoga, pranayama, or meditation. Not afterthoughts squeezed into leftover corners but intentionally designed sacred spaces that support concentration and inner stillness.


Water Consciousness: Natural water storage systems using copper and silver vessels (traditionally believed to purify water and offer health benefits), aesthetically integrated rainwater harvesting that recharges groundwater, and water features that cool spaces naturally while creating the healing sounds of flowing water.


Community Connection: Courtyards and common areas designed for multi-generational gathering, storytelling, festival celebrations, and the kind of spontaneous human connection that builds social resilience.


Child-Friendly Learning Environments: Spaces where children can climb trees, get muddy, help with composting, assist in gardens, and learn life skills through direct engagement with natural cycles rather than through screens alone.

The Economic Renaissance Hidden in Ancient Wisdom


Skeptics might ask: “This sounds beautiful, but is it practical? Can we afford to build this way?”
The deeper question is: Can we afford not to?


Consider the economic mathematics of Bharatiya architecture:


Health Cost Reductions: Buildings designed with Vastu principles and natural materials can dramatically reduce respiratory issues, stress-related illnesses, and mental health problems. The money saved on healthcare often exceeds any additional construction costs within a few years, aligning with principles of “healthy buildings” and “wellness real estate.” This is a claim and also an area for research.


Energy Independence: Structures that work with climate rather than against it require minimal artificial cooling, heating, and lighting. Passive cooling and heating techniques, solar water heating, natural ventilation, and thermal mass cooling can reduce energy bills by 60-80%.


Local Economic Stimulation: Using local materials and traditional techniques creates employment for rural artisans, keeps construction money within regional economies, and revives endangered craft skills that can become tourism assets.


Property Value Enhancement: As awareness grows about the health and environmental benefits of traditional building methods, properties incorporating these elements often command premium prices and attract conscious buyers.


Reduced Maintenance: Traditional materials like lime plaster, stone, and properly treated wood often outlast modern alternatives by decades, reducing long-term maintenance costs. Lime plaster, for instance, is breathable and self-healing.

The Artisan Renaissance


At the heart of this transformation lies a renaissance we desperately need: the revival of traditional craftsmanship. Modern construction often reduces human beings to mechanical operators—installing mass-produced components with minimal skill or creativity. Bharatiya architecture demands artisans—individuals who understand materials intimately, who can read the land and respond to local conditions, who bring both technical skill and artistic vision to their work.


Training a new generation of sthapatis (traditional master architects and sculptors) and mistris (master craftsmen or builders) doesn’t just preserve cultural heritage. It creates meaningful employment that can’t be outsourced or automated away. It builds local economic resilience. It connects young people to traditions that give their work deeper meaning than mere economic transaction.
 
We need architecture schools that teach both AutoCAD and ancient proportional systems. Construction programs that train students in concrete engineering and traditional lime mortar techniques. Design curricula that include both modern building codes and Vastu principles.
This integration isn’t about choosing sides between traditional and modern. It’s about creating synthesis—bringing the tested wisdom of centuries into conversation with contemporary needs and possibilities.

A Dharmic Vision for Urban Transformation

Cities are living, breathing organisms. They pulse with life through their green spaces, flow through their water bodies, and hum with the stories of their people. Yet, over decades of rapid urbanization, this harmony has been lost. Greenery has given way to concrete, air has turned heavy with pollution, and the cultural soul of our cities has been diluted.
 
But this is not irreversible. Cities can be reclaimed—not just as places to live, but as spaces that inspire, nurture, and connect us to nature and each other. To achieve this, we need a Dharmic approach—one that emphasizes balance, respect for natural and cultural systems, and the collective responsibility of all citizens.
 
This article presents a roadmap to transform cities into vibrant ecosystems where nature, culture, and humanity thrive together.
 
1. Policies That Set the Foundation for Harmony
 
Urban transformation begins with bold policies rooted in sustainability, equity, and long-term thinking.
 
Green Spaces are mandatory – cannot be optional!
 
Green spaces are not luxuries—they are essential lifelines for any city. Policies must mandate that a significant portion of urban land is reserved for parks, forests, and gardens. These spaces should be accessible to all, improving air quality, promoting physical and mental well-being, and fostering a sense of community.
 
We need beautiful water bodies in addition to green spaces!
 
Neglected lakes, ponds, and wetlands must be revived—not just as functional water reserves but as vibrant ecological and social hubs. These water bodies cool cities, support biodiversity, and provide spaces for reflection and recreation.
 
Tree Planting Should be Done Strategically and Scientifically
 
Planting trees isn’t just about numbers; it’s about understanding. Indigenous species like Peepal, Banyan, Amla, and Ashoka are not only culturally significant but also critical for improving air quality and supporting local ecosystems.


 
Quiet Zones and No-Vehicle Days


Noise pollution disrupts not only our mental well-being but also the delicate balance of urban ecology. Designate quiet zones where noise is strictly regulated. Introduce no-vehicle hours every week and vehicle-free days every month to reclaim peace and reduce emissions.
 
Temples are energy vortexes (not just places of prayer and worship) that are vital for metal health of citizens
 
In the Indian tradition, temples are more than places of worship—they are centers of positive energy. Strategically locating temples near green spaces and water bodies can amplify their impact, creating sanctuaries for spiritual renewal and community gathering.


Design Should Blend Aesthetics with Functionality
 
Indian aesthetics emphasize harmony and meaning. Public spaces and buildings should reflect this ethos. Murals, carvings, and thoughtful architectural designs can tell a city’s stories while serving practical purposes. This is how we weave beauty into the fabric of everyday life.
 
2. Builders Should be Seen as Custodians of the Future – but they need education.
 
Builders and developers shape the physical identity of our cities. They must see themselves as custodians of harmony, responsible for designing spaces that honor nature, culture, and inclusivity.
 
Eco-Friendly Design Principles – through education, policy and inspiration
 
Incorporate green roofs, vertical gardens, natural ventilation, and sustainable materials into all urban developments. These aren’t just trends; they are necessities.
 
Water Conservation Should be incorporated in Every Project
 
Rainwater harvesting, greywater recycling, and artificial wetlands should be standard features in every building plan. These systems are critical for cities grappling with water scarcity and urban flooding.
